cms icon indicating copy to clipboard operation
cms copied to clipboard

关于命令模式下数据迁移到达梦的问题

Open lmq219-123 opened this issue 1 year ago • 3 comments

用最新版7.2.2 进行升级改旧系统到达梦数据的问题: 1、执行sscms data restore -d update到达梦时会报错,无法将数据更新成功,报错位置:Datory/Utils/RepositoryUtils.Insert.cs的 await connection.ExecuteAsync(sqlString, parameterList); 2、用达梦数据库重新安装不成功,会重新跳转安装页,原因是user_tables表中没有owner字段,出错位置Datory/DatabaseImpl/DmLmpl.cs中的SQL语法。 测试环境: 1、数据库:dm8 2、操作系统:中标麒麟、windows

lmq219-123 avatar Oct 27 '23 08:10 lmq219-123

收到,我们查一下代码

starlying avatar Oct 30 '23 00:10 starlying

已修复,到官网下载最新版本更新再试试。

starlying avatar Oct 31 '23 00:10 starlying

测试了一下,sscms data restore -d update的执行还是有问题,自己更新了DM的批量更新代码,重构了InsertRowsAsync()方法和新增针对DM的BulkInsertAsync()方法

lmq219-123 avatar Nov 03 '23 01:11 lmq219-123